Just my experiences with compiling unzip-5.52 (blfs-cvsl-2005-11-20 on 
LFS-SVN-20051116, followed to the letter)

1) 
patch -Np1 -i ../unzip-5.52-fix_Makefile-1.patch
FAILED at 878 (?)
on inspecting the Makefile 
+       ln -sf libunzip.so.0.4 libunzip.so
already seemed to be applied.  So is this patch necessary?

2)
make prefix=/usr LOCAL_UNZIP=-DUSE_UNSHRINK linux_shlibz
gave an error at the end (I forget which now; am still working with the old 
system) but libunzip.so.0 and libunzip.so.0.4 were built, and all tests 
passed (apart from the time difference.)
So I think I have a working unzip, but am confused --
